1Mow.
2No Bullingbroke: If euer I were Traitor,
3My name be blotted from the booke of Life,
4And I from heauen banish'd, as from hence:
5But what thou art, heauen, thou, and I do know,
6And all too soone (I feare) the King shall rue.
7Farewell (my Liege) now no way can I stray,
8Saue backe to England, all the worlds my way.
